From 124df4ee35030b5858a89a7cafe9cbf1e5eea043 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ed Bartosh Date: Sat, 3 Dec 2016 01:48:06 +0200 Subject: selftest: wic: fix test_qemu Setting WKS_FILE variable in qemux86-64 made wic test to use wrong wks file to produce an image and resulted in test_qemu failure. Used conditional assignment in qemux86-64 and explicitly set WKS_FILE in wic testing suite to make the suite to use wic-image-minimal.wsk. This should fix test_qemu failure.
